    • Cuneiform is an ancient writing system that originated in Mesopotamia (modern-day Iraq) around 3500 BCE. It was used by various civilizations, including the Sumerians, Babylonians, and Assyrians, to record laws, business transactions, literature, and even mathematics. The system consists of over 600 symbols, including logograms, phonetic signs, and determinatives, which were inscribed on clay tablets using a reed stylus. As archaeologists continue to uncover more cuneiform tablets, researchers are learning more about the cultures that created this writing system.

  • Logograms: Cuneiform symbols represent words or concepts, rather than sounds. For example, the symbol for "king" would be written as a logogram, indicating the concept rather than the sound.
  • Phonetic signs: Cuneiform also includes phonetic signs, which represent sounds. These signs are used to write words and phrases.
